Multiply 70/3 with 63/21

1st number: 23 1/3, 2nd number: 3 0/21

This multiplication involving fractions can also be rephrased as "What is 70/3 of 3 0/21?"

70/3 × 63/21 is 70/1.

Steps for multiplying fractions

  1. Simply multiply the numerators and denominators separately:
  2. 70/3 × 63/21 = 70 × 63/3 × 21 = 4410/63
  3.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 70/1
